Sustainability, is increasingly positioned at the top of board agendas and is now central to corporate competitiveness and a company’s continued ability to operate. The financial services industry has a crucial role to play in transitioning to a more sustainable world, through steering capital away from the most polluting companies and towards those demonstrating environmental and social leadership.
